During the past decade, the concept of a smart campus has gained significant attention in the academic community. Essentially, the concept of a smart campus is about utilization of novel technology to build valuable services, that integrate to all aspects of the life on campus. Universities around the world have created initiatives to transform their campuses into smart ones, and significant research has been published on the topic. Through a literature review of this existing research, and an empirical case study focusing on user experiences of a particular smart campus mobile application through a theory of application domains, this master’s thesis explores the topic from the viewpoint of smart campus mobile applications. The main goals of this research are to build an understanding of which features and technologies are commonly utilized in support of such mobile applications, whether there’s interest in integrating artificial intelligence to such applications, and which domains of life on campus the applications’ usage serves in practice. The results indicate the domains of Smart Living and Learning dominate the usage and features of smart campus mobile applications, with the applications taking a major role in supporting both daily life, and learning-related activities on physical campus. It was also found that wide variety of technologies are utilized to support the features of these applications, with mobile, data computing & storage, and IoT technology being most common, with artificial intelligence seeing less usage, but significant future potential. Additionally, it was found that several general qualities can increase usefulness and convenience of smart campus mobile applications. With these results, this research provides a theoretical contribution by presenting user-centric viewpoint into what role mobile applications usually play in the context of the smart campus and its application domains. As a practical contribution, this research provides ideas and recommendations that can help educational institutions implement and improve their own mobile applications.
